Abstract:Two sampling transects for chlorophyll a (Chl.a) between inner bay and the mouth of bay were performed and one sampling station in kelp zone was daily sampled once every 2 hours in May and August,2014 in Sanggou Bay.The spatial distribution and diurnal variation characteristics of Chl.a were studied,and the correlations between Chl.a concentration and physical and chemical factors were analyzed by combining with the environmental factors such as temperature,salt,pH,nutrients and so on in Sanggou Bay,the change of Chl.a and its influencing factor were discussed pre-and-post-the-harvest of kelp in Sanggou Bay.(1) For the voyage survey,Chl.a concentration was significantly higher in summer than in spring in Sanggou Bay.In spring,the average Chl.a concentration in the surface layer and the bottom layer were 0.67±0.39 μg/L,0.50±0.31 μg/L,respectively,and Chl.a concentration was higher in the surface layer than in the bottom layer.The general trend of Chl.a concentration was decreasing from inner bay to the outside of the bay in surface layer in spring.In summer,the average Chl.a concentrations in the surface layer and the bottom layer were 3.39±1.53 μg/L and 3.12±1.43 μg/L,respectively,and Chl.a concentration was higher in the surface layer than in the bottom layer.The kelp area showed the highest values Chl.a concentrations and shellfish area showed the lowest values in the surface layer in summer.The kelp area and shellfish area showed the highest values Chl.a concentrations and outer site of the bay showed the lowest values in the bottom layer in summer.(2) The results of continuous observation showed that Chl.a concentration was in the range of 0.24-0.95 μg/L,and the average value were 0.70 ± 0.19 μg/L in spring in kelp zone.There was less fluctuation for Chl.a concentration day and night in spring.In summer,Chl.a concentration was in the range of 2.01-4.66 μg/L,and the average value were 3.04 ± 0.82 μg/L in kelp zone.There was greater fluctuation for Chl.a concentration day and night in summer.The Chl.a concentration in spring was significantly higher than those in summer.And the nutrient concentration,Si/P,N/P and Si/N ratio in spring were significantly lower than that in the summer.(3) There was a significantly positive correlation between Chl.a concentration and temperature or silicate concentration in the surface layer in spring.And Chl.a was significantly positive correlation with salinity in the bottom layer in summer.The distribution of Chl.a is commonly affected by temperature,silicate,salinity,marine cultures and hydrological environment pre-and-post-the-harvest of kelp in Sanggou Bay.The multi-trophic aquaculture mode of bivalves and seaweeds is important influence factor of Chl.a distribution and variation in Sanggou Bay.
